Leaf Peeping has Begun !

    Yesterday I had occasion to drive 230 miles, to the eastern side of the state, up to the Canadian border, and back home. As the crow flies that would be 150 miles; but then, I guess, it would not be Vermont. I live in the most densely populated area of the state (about 43,000), on the edge of Lake Champlain, and our weather is not as alpine as the rest (it’s not uncommon for me, like yesterday, to be driving up a ridge-line and the elevation gives my ears a pop). So, a trip like yesterday’s unmasked the foliage event accelerated for me: it has begun!
    There are foliage maps (which presumably are scientific averages), and other methods for recommendations; yet what you really want to pay attention to is “the Cross State Travel Map” (https://accd.vermont.gov/covid-19/restart/cross-state-travel). Yes, if you are able, come enjoy Leaf Peeping Season! And just know, that this year, planning includes this extra wrinkle.
    The images posted were taken yesterday, and the next five and a half weeks, as stated, have begun. See if you can make it to the northern half of the state this time for a different spin on awesome.
